She is too adorable!!! I am not sure if this is a good idea or not but why don't you wait a few more months and maybe she'll gain some weight before the spay? We had Chase neutered at 8 months. He was 4 pounds at 5 months and 7 pounds at 8 months. I know you want to spay b4 her first heat but I think you may have some time before that. Again--I am no expert but it's just something you may want to look into. |

I have been holding off on my girls spay... she will be done next week at just over 9 months old... since the likelihood of her going into heat before a year was small I decided to let her grow more before spaying, as opposed to spaying at 6 months. |
